South African Association for Language Teaching (SAALT) Conference
19 to 21 June 2023
Time Square Sun International Hotel (The Maslow) - Pretoria, GautengTheme: Advancing multilingualism – mining the wealth of our languages

Keynote Speakers 2023

Professor Piet Van Avermaet

Abstract Title

“Multilingualism, language of schooling and equity in education in Europe. How to move beyond binaries?”

Prof Christa van der Walt

Abstract Title

Possibilities for multilingual education during lockdowns.

Dr Theuns Eloff

Abstract Title

Mother-tongue eduation in South African Schools – a pipe dream?

Professor Pamela Maseko

Abstract Title

Engaging the African language literary archive: prospects for the diversification of the academic canon in South African higher education

Professor Langa Khumalo

Abstract Title

Challenging the English hegemony: Enhancing multilingualism in Digital Humanities.

Safety Tips

  • Do not leave valuable items unattended, near windows or on car seats.
  • Never walk alone, stay in a group of 2 or more.
  • Avoid taking the same route every day (only if leaving the conference venue).
  • Tell someone where you are going and how long you expect to be away.
  • Never accept a lift from a stranger.
  • Share your e-hailing ride information electronically with someone (via WhatsApp, SMS, etc).
  • Keep your wallet/purse /cell phone on your person, not in back pockets of trousers.
  • Avoid carrying large amounts of money with you and be aware of your surroundings when paying for purchases.
  • Avoid talking on your cell phone while walking in public areas – be aware of people around you.
  • Keep your hotel room key safe and use the safe in the room to store valuable items.
